The 2025 Royal Rumble will take place this Saturday 1st February from Lucas Oil Stadium in Indianapolis, Indiana. This is the first Royal Rumble to take place from the venue. On the card there will be two Royal Rumble matches, a men’s and a women’s Royal Rumble. This guide will preview the men’s match.
It’s unlikely Kane’s record of eliminations is to be overtaken in this match, as the man with the most eliminations in the match announced so far (John Cena) is 20 eliminations behind. However a number of people could get close to Chris Jericho’s time in the match. Of the names announced Rey Mysterio would need to go 55 minutes to overtake Chris Jericho. Randy Orton – who hasn’t been announced for the match yet – could theoretically compete and would need about 25 minutes to overtake Y2J. Both are unlikely to occur.
A number of wrestlers could increase their time to over 3 hours spent in cumulative time in the Royal Rumble match: of the names announced – John Cena, Roman Reigns and Seth Rollins are each about a quarter of an hour to 20 minutes away from the feat. Drew McIntyre could also break that feat, although he is 40 minutes away. Of the names that aren’t announced, Kofi Kingston is also about 15 minutes away from the 3 hour mark.
Roman Reigns could enter the top 5 of most eliminations in the Royal Rumble with 4 eliminations. If Reigns eliminates 6 people, he will make himself third in the list of top threats in the Royal Rumble. Bron Breakker could make a big impact with a number of quick eliminations and be high on the most efficient Royal Rumble competitors.
A fun stat is associated with the Iron Men of the Royal Rumble. If the Iron Man draws number 1 (which has happened 15 times before), then it will set a record of the most consecutive drawings of the same number for the Iron Men. From Edge in 2021 to Jey Uso last year, every Iron Man has drawn number 1 (Drew McIntyre came from number 16 in 2020). There had been 4 consecutive years that the Iron Men have drawn number one as well from 2011 to 2014, so if the Iron Man is #1, there will be a new record.

Stats of Announced Names
Names in order of the number of entries they’ve had.
| Position | Wrestler | Entries | Number Of Wins | Number of Top 4 Finishes | Average Finish | Total Time In Match | Number of Eliminations | Eliminations/Rumble | Time/Elimination |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1. | Rey Mysterio | 14 | 1 | 2 | 12.14 | 4:05:38 | 16 | 1.143 | 15:21 |
| 2. | John Cena | 8 | 2 | 5 | 3.63 | 2:42:25 | 25 | 3.125 | 06:30 |
| 3. | Drew McIntyre | 8 | 1 | 3 | 10.13 | 2:24:33 | 17 | 2.125 | 08:30 |
| 4. | CM Punk | 7 | 0 | 2 | 12.29 | 3:10:02 | 20 | 2.857 | 09:30 |
| 5. | Roman Reigns | 6 | 1 | 6 | 2 | 2:43:36 | 32 | 5.333 | 05:07 |
| 6. | Seth Rollins | 6 | 1 | 3 | 4.5 | 2:41:00 | 18 | 3.00 | 8:57 |
| 7. | Shinsuke Nakamura | 6 | 1 | 1 | 19.17 | 1:51:16 | 4 | 4 | 27:49 |
| 8. | Sami Zayn | 6 | 0 | 0 | 18 | 1:17:57 | 3 | 0.500 | 25:59 |
| 9. | Jey Uso | 3 | 0 | 0 | 11 | 1:02:21 | 1 | 0.333 | 1:02:21 |
| 10. | Chad Gable | 3 | 0 | 0 | 23 | 25:17 | 1 | 0.333 | 25:17 |
| 11. | Bron Breakker | 1 | 0 | 0 | 13 | 05:19 | 4 | 4 | 01:20 |
| 12. | Carmelo Hayes | 1 | 0 | 0 | 25 | 17:06 | 1 | 1 | 17:06 |
| 13. | Logan Paul | 1 | 0 | 1 | 3 | 10:57 | 1 | 1 | 10:57 |
Confirmed Debutants: LA Knight, Penta
